Amitriptynol is a chemical compound that serves as a pharmaceutical intermediate. Its structure is characterized by a dibenzocycloheptene core with a dimethylaminopropyl side chain and a tertiary alcohol group.

The international HS code for Amitriptynol (CAS 1159-03-1) is 2922.19.
2922.19
2922 19 00
Classification per the EU customs inventory ECICS (2026-07 snapshot, HS 2022). National tariff lines and product form can affect the final classification.
